What Central Texas College District graduates make
Median salaries by major and degree level, 1–10 years after graduation. Click any program for percentiles, national comparison and the payback calculator.
Associate (42)
| Major | 1 yr | 5 yrs | 10 yrs |
|---|---|---|---|
| Air Transportation | $47,802 | $57,372 | $106,578 |
|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ment Professions | $56,877 | — | — |
| Biological and Biomedical Sciences | $31,694 | $47,392 | $53,578 |
| Biology, General | $31,694 | $47,392 | $53,578 |
| Business Administration, Management and Operations | $38,875 | $49,399 | $59,353 |
| Business Operations Support and Assistant Services | $31,317 | $39,919 | $47,119 |
| Business, Management, Marketing, and Related Support Services | $37,067 | $48,517 | $61,121 |
| Business/Commerce, General | $38,234 | $49,653 | $64,108 |
|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ions | $48,284 | $54,522 | $61,827 |
| Computer Engineering Technologies/Technicians | $58,659 | $58,065 | $74,301 |
| Computer Programming | $46,571 | $61,332 | $65,282 |
| Computer and Information Sciences and Support Services | $46,450 | $59,754 | $66,537 |
| Computer/Information Technology Administration and Management | $46,359 | $58,808 | $67,343 |
| Criminal Justice and Corrections | $42,353 | $52,221 | $60,484 |
| Drafting/Design Engineering Technologies/Technicians | $39,655 | $48,487 | $65,986 |
| Engineering/Engineering-Related Technologies/Technicians | $44,849 | $51,223 | $70,679 |
| Family and Consumer Sciences/Human Sciences | $29,433 | $36,215 | $41,019 |
| Health Professions and Related Programs | $64,880 | $77,289 | $86,910 |
| Health and Medical Administrative Services | $28,969 | — | — |
| Heating, Air Conditioning, Ventilation and Refrigeration Maintenance Technology/Technician (HAC, HACR, HVAC, HVACR) | $40,342 | — | — |
| Homeland Security, Law Enforcement, Firefighting and Related Protective Services | $42,838 | $52,221 | $60,484 |
| Hospitality Administration/Management | $35,298 | $51,223 | $60,738 |
| Human Development, Family Studies, and Related Services | $29,433 | $36,215 | $41,019 |
| Legal Professions and Studies | $32,986 | $43,216 | $55,307 |
| Legal Support Services | $32,986 | $43,216 | $55,307 |
|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and Humanities | $37,739 | $51,561 | $63,172 |
|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and Humanities | $37,739 | $51,561 | $63,172 |
| Mathematics | $28,199 | $49,171 | — |
| Mathematics and Statistics | $28,199 | $49,171 | — |
| Mechanic and Repair Technologies/Technicians | $43,047 | $54,051 | — |
| Mental and Social Health Services and Allied Professions | $32,445 | $39,032 | $47,574 |
| Multi/Interdisciplinary Studies | $38,857 | $58,188 | $64,770 |
| Multi/Interdisciplinary Studies, Other | $38,857 | $58,188 | $64,770 |
| Parks, Recreation, Leisure, Fitness, and Kinesiology | $25,009 | — | — |
| Public Administration | $52,354 | $69,154 | — |
| Public Administration and Social Service Professions | $52,354 | $69,154 | — |
|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ical Nursing | $69,837 | $81,750 | $92,205 |
| Social Sciences | $27,419 | $43,722 | $59,105 |
| Social Sciences, General | $27,419 | $43,722 | $59,105 |
| Sports, Kinesiology, and Physical Education/Fitness | $25,009 | — | — |
| Transportation and Materials Moving | $47,802 | $57,372 | $106,578 |
| Visual and Performing Arts | $22,038 | $35,145 | — |
